Definition of "regeln" in German

#1

etwas durch Regeln, Vorschriften oder Gesetze ordnen; etwas steuern oder kontrollieren.

DE: Die Ampel regelt den Verkehr.

A1
EN: “The traffic light regulates the traffic.

DE: Ein neues Schild regelt hier das Parken.

A2
EN: “A new sign regulates parking here.

DE: Die Hausordnung regelt das Zusammenleben im Gebäude.

B1
EN: “The house rules regulate living together in the building.
#2

eine Angelegenheit oder ein Problem klären; etwas organisieren oder in Ordnung bringen.

DE: Ich regele das morgen.

A1
EN: “I'll sort it out tomorrow.

DE: Wir müssen noch regeln, wer das Auto fährt.

A2
EN: “We still need to sort out who is driving the car.

DE: Bevor wir in den Urlaub fahren, müssen wir noch ein paar Dinge regeln.

B1
EN: “Before we go on vacation, we still have to arrange a few things.
